Description: Discover the mysteries of Minecraft Legends, a new action strategy game. Explore a gentle land of rich resources and lush biomes on the brink of destruction. The ravaging piglins have arrived, and it’s up to you to inspire your allies and lead them in strategic battles to save the Overworld!

Publisher: Xbox Game Studios

Developer: Mojang Studios

Release Date: 18.04.2023

For an optimal cloud gaming experience, the requirements aren’t typically determined by the individual games like Minecraft Legends but rather the cloud gaming service and desired streaming quality.

Here’s a general breakdown:

  • Basic Gameplay: A minimum internet speed of 5 to 15 Mbps is usually required.
  • 4K Cloud Gaming: For the best 4K streaming experience, a bandwidth of at least 40 Mbps is recommended.
